U.S. Army Infantry troops advance during Battle of Okinawa

The Battle of Okinawa, during World War II. U.S. Infantry troops advance on a road lined by trees on an island of Okinawa. White phosphorous bombs exploded to signal aircraft. A U.S. soldier among the bushes. White flares and fumes rise from the wooded region due to white phosphorous bombs bursts. U.S. soldiers advance among the bushes and trees. Positions in the jungle sprayed with flamethrowers by the soldiers.

U.S. infantry troops search for Japanese troops in the village of Kin in Okinawa, Japan during Battle of Okinawa of WWII.

Battle of Okinawa in Japan, during World War II. U.S. Infantry troops advance on a road lined by trees in the village of Kin in Okinawa. The soldiers, holding guns, move in front of the houses in the village. Women and children seated in front of the houses. Children watch the soldiers in front of a building. A board, with letters written in Japanese. The U.S. soldiers with the villagers. Soldiers inspecting Japanese uniforms. The soldiers searching for Japanese troops in the village. The Japanese troops dressed as villagers being led away by the U.S. troops.

U.S military police move civilians from a village to make way for an air base, in Okinawa, Japan

Evacuation of civilians of Okinawa in Japan, during World War II. U.S. MP (Military Police) in a village in Okinawa in Japan. The MP with the civilians in the streets of the village. The Military Police and a few women of the village in front of a hut. The women talk among themselves. One of the MP wearing a helmet with the letters 'MP' written on it. Civilians, holding their belongings, walk through the streets of the village. The civilians in an enclosure. The MP among a group of civilians which includes elderly people. The civilians are helped into trucks by the MP for evacuation from the village which is to be the site of an air base. A group of civilians walk with their belongings. Trucks loaded with civilians in view. The trucks move along the road. Huts on the side of the road. A Military Police on a horse leads a large group of civilians who carry their belongings. Children in the group. The group walks along the road. The group includes men, women, children and elderly people.

Okinawan workers at work in the area of the village which is the proposed site for an air base, in Okinawa, Japan during WWII.

Okinawan workers during the work of an airstrip in Okinawa, Japan, during World War II. The workers in a village in Okinawa, gather in a group. The workers move in a line to a desk where a pair of U.S. Military Police are seated. Each worker signs on a document. A policeman looks on. Few policemen stand behind the desk. The workers bow to an officer who walks past them. The workers move in a group. A few men in the group eating out of a bowl. The group of workers in a field which is the proposed site for the air base. The workers move in a line along a road. A few workers,with hammers in their hands, at work in the area. Sacks of sand stacked by the workers. Workers along the side of a road. Trucks with material move along the road. Heavy equipment grading the ground for the airstrip. Workers operate heavy equipment. A few workers painting the roof and sides of a building in the area. Aircraft taking off from the new airstrip.
